Output 10c66a132ef9a84f1d542080336900f0b9e856711726d385493a18f61f11b22a:33

value
595078
script pubkey
OP_0 OP_PUSHBYTES_20 c9893b4ae2e7844ed1866a07bc26b805016a22e7
address
bc1qexynkjhzu7zya5vxdgrmcf4cq5qk5gh8rka7yc
transaction
10c66a132ef9a84f1d542080336900f0b9e856711726d385493a18f61f11b22a
spent
true